WTO Negotiations and Agricultural Trade LiberalizationThe Effect of Developed Countries' Policies on Developing Countries\nAuthor(s): Eugenio Diaz-Bonilla, Soren Frandsen, Sherman Robinson\nFormat: Hardback\nPublisher: CABI Publishing, United Kingdom\nImprint: CABI Publishing\nISBN-13: 9781845930509, 978-1845930509\nSynopsis\nThe purpose of this book is to analyze the effects of developed countries' agricultural policies on developing countries. The main focus is on food security, poverty and other topics such as multifunctionality, biotechnology and regional agreements, as an input to policy reform within the World Trade Organization (WTO) trade negotiations. The book arises from a joint project between the Food and Resource Economics Institute in Denmark and the International Food Policy Research Institute in Washington.
